Understanding Tattoo Removal in IslamabadTattoo Removal in Islamabad is commonly performed using Q-switched or pico laser technology. These lasers target the ink pigments beneath the skin and break them into tiny particles. The body’s immune system gradually removes these fragmented pigments over time. This method is considered safer and more precise than older techniques like dermabrasion or surgical excision.
Clinics in the capital city offer modern equipment and trained practitioners. The procedure is usually done in multiple sessions depending on tattoo size, colour, and depth. Black ink is generally easier to remove compared to bright colours like green or blue. Each session is spaced several weeks apart to allow the skin to heal properly.
Who Is an Ideal Candidate?Not everyone responds to laser treatment in the same way. People with healthy skin and realistic expectations are usually good candidates. Individuals without active skin infections or chronic skin diseases often achieve better results. Your medical history plays a key role in determining your suitability.
Those with lighter skin tones may experience quicker fading because the laser can target ink more easily. However, modern lasers are designed to treat various skin types safely. A consultation with a qualified practitioner ensures that your skin type and tattoo characteristics are properly assessed.
Factors That Determine SuitabilitySeveral factors influence whether laser removal is right for you. These include medical conditions, skin sensitivity, and lifestyle habits. It is important to have a professional evaluation before starting treatment. The following factors are commonly considered:
- Skin type and tone.
- Age and overall health condition.
- Tattoo size, location, and ink colours.
- History of keloid scarring.
- Pregnancy or breastfeeding status.
A thorough assessment ensures safe and customised treatment planning. Patients who follow pre and post-treatment guidelines often achieve smoother results.
Who Should Avoid Laser Tattoo Removal?Certain individuals may need to postpone or avoid the procedure. Pregnant or breastfeeding women are generally advised to wait. People with active infections or open wounds in the treatment area should first complete healing. Those with severe skin disorders must consult a dermatologist before proceeding.
Patients prone to hypertrophic or keloid scars require special caution. The laser process can sometimes trigger abnormal scarring in sensitive individuals. A patch test may be recommended to observe how your skin reacts. Professional guidance minimises unnecessary risks.
What to Expect During the Procedure?The procedure usually begins with cleansing the treatment area. A cooling device or numbing cream may be applied to reduce discomfort. The laser device is then used to deliver short pulses of energy into the skin. Many patients describe the sensation as similar to a rubber band snapping against the skin.
Each session lasts between 15 to 45 minutes depending on tattoo size. Mild redness and swelling are common immediately after treatment. These side effects typically subside within a few days. Following aftercare instructions is essential for proper healing.
Recovery and AftercareAfter each session, the treated area may feel tender and slightly irritated. Applying prescribed ointments and avoiding direct sunlight is highly recommended. Wearing loose clothing helps prevent friction against the treated skin. Keeping the area clean reduces the risk of infection.
Complete removal may require multiple sessions over several months. Patience is important because the fading process takes time. Proper hydration and a healthy lifestyle can support faster recovery. Regular follow-ups ensure that progress is monitored safely.
Are There Any Risks?Like any cosmetic procedure, laser tattoo removal carries minor risks. Temporary pigmentation changes may occur, especially in darker skin tones. Some individuals experience mild blistering or scabbing. These reactions usually heal without long-term effects when managed correctly.
Choosing a reputable clinic significantly reduces complications. Certified practitioners use advanced equipment tailored for different skin types. Honest consultation about expectations and limitations is crucial. Understanding both benefits and risks leads to better satisfaction.

FAQs About Tattoo Removal in IslamabadHow many sessions are required?Most people require between 6 to 10 sessions. The exact number depends on tattoo size, colour, and skin type.
Is the procedure painful?Mild discomfort is common, but it is usually tolerable. Numbing creams and cooling devices help minimise pain.
Will the tattoo disappear completely?Many tattoos fade significantly or completely. However, some stubborn colours may leave faint traces.
Are there permanent side effects?Serious side effects are rare when performed by professionals. Temporary redness or pigmentation changes may occur.
